Why Bitcoin Rallies Are Fading Without New Liquidity

Bitcoin

Bitcoin’s latest pullback is being driven less by headline price moves and more by a quiet but important shift in capital flows.

Key Takeaways

  • New investor inflows into Bitcoin have turned negative, leaving sell-offs largely unabsorbed.
  • Current behavior aligns more with early bear-market conditions than healthy bull-market dips.
  • Sentiment data shows dip-buying is fragile, with rebounds losing momentum quickly.
  • Heavy selling pressure has neutralized the usual multiplier effect of new capital.

New on-chain data from CryptoQuant shows that new investor inflows have flipped negative, meaning fresh money is no longer stepping in to absorb selling pressure. Instead of buyers viewing declines as opportunities, capital is leaving the market, reinforcing downside momentum.

Historically, this type of behavior tends to appear when a cycle is losing strength rather than during routine bull-market pauses. In past bull phases, even sharp drops were met with renewed demand. The absence of that response is what makes the current environment stand out.

Why this looks different from a normal bull-market dip

CryptoQuant analysts highlight that bull-market corrections usually act as magnets for new capital. Drawdowns create urgency, pulling sidelined money back into the market and helping prices stabilize quickly. That mechanism is currently missing.

Instead, each wave of weakness is met with hesitation. Investors appear more focused on preserving capital than chasing rebounds, which limits follow-through on the upside. As a result, rallies struggle to extend beyond short-term relief moves before running into renewed selling.

Sentiment data confirms fragile dip-buying behavior

This cautious tone is echoed in sentiment and behavioral data from Santiment. Its latest insights suggest that 2026’s volatility has eroded confidence in dip-buying strategies. Social chatter and trading patterns show that optimism tends to spike only after extreme fear, and even then, it fades quickly.

Rather than signaling conviction, these rebounds often reflect short covering or tactical trades. Once that demand is exhausted, prices lose momentum again, reinforcing the view that the market lacks a solid liquidity base.

Bitcoin is not “pumpable” under current conditions

Ki Young Ju describes the current setup bluntly: Bitcoin is not pumpable right now. He points to the contrast between recent years to explain why. In 2024, relatively modest inflows had an outsized impact on Bitcoin’s valuation, creating a strong multiplier effect.

That dynamic broke down in 2025. Despite substantial capital moving through the ecosystem, Bitcoin’s market capitalization declined, showing that selling pressure overwhelmed incoming demand. Until that imbalance eases, attempts to force upside momentum are likely to fail.

Liquidity is now the key constraint

Bitcoin’s significantly larger market cap has changed the rules of the game. Higher valuations require a steady level of circulating liquidity just to be maintained. Analysts warn that ongoing stablecoin outflows and a shrinking stablecoin market cap are clear signals that this liquidity is not currently available.

As long as that trend persists, any recovery in BTC is likely to be temporary. Sustainable upside would require not just buyers, but a broader expansion in available capital across the crypto ecosystem.

Macro data could decide the next move

The outlook is not fixed. Liquidity conditions can shift quickly if the broader environment improves and investors regain the ability to look past short-term uncertainty. This week’s inflation and unemployment data are therefore in focus, as they could influence expectations around monetary policy and risk appetite.

If macro signals turn supportive, capital could flow back into stablecoins and risk assets, giving Bitcoin a firmer foundation. Until then, analysts caution that rallies may continue to fade, reflecting a market still waiting for liquidity to return.

The Channel Factories We’ve Been Waiting For

The Channel Factories We’ve Been Waiting For

The post The Channel Factories We’ve Been Waiting For appeared on BitcoinEthereumNews.com. Visions of future technology are often prescient about the broad strokes while flubbing the details. The tablets in “2001: A Space Odyssey” do indeed look like iPads, but you never see the astronauts paying for subscriptions or wasting hours on Candy Crush.  Channel factories are one vision that arose early in the history of the Lightning Network to address some challenges that Lightning has faced from the beginning. Despite having grown to become Bitcoin’s most successful layer-2 scaling solution, with instant and low-fee payments, Lightning’s scale is limited by its reliance on payment channels. Although Lightning shifts most transactions off-chain, each payment channel still requires an on-chain transaction to open and (usually) another to close. As adoption grows, pressure on the blockchain grows with it. The need for a more scalable approach to managing channels is clear. Channel factories were supposed to meet this need, but where are they? In 2025, subnetworks are emerging that revive the impetus of channel factories with some new details that vastly increase their potential. They are natively interoperable with Lightning and achieve greater scale by allowing a group of participants to open a shared multisig UTXO and create multiple bilateral channels, which reduces the number of on-chain transactions and improves capital efficiency. Achieving greater scale by reducing complexity, Ark and Spark perform the same function as traditional channel factories with new designs and additional capabilities based on shared UTXOs.  Channel Factories 101 Channel factories have been around since the inception of Lightning. A factory is a multiparty contract where multiple users (not just two, as in a Dryja-Poon channel) cooperatively lock funds in a single multisig UTXO. They can open, close and update channels off-chain without updating the blockchain for each operation. Only when participants leave or the factory dissolves is an on-chain transaction…
